Per Olov Enquist (23 September 1934 – 25 April 2020) was a Swedish author.

He worked as a journalist, playwright and novelist. He became well-known around the world with his novel The Visit of the Royal Physician (1999). His awards include Nordic Council Literature Prize (1968), Dobloug Prize (1988), Nelly Sachs Prize (2003) and Swedish Academy Nordic Prize (2010). Some of his works have been translated from Swedish to English by Tiina Nunnally.

Enquist was born in Hjoggböle, a village in present-day Skellefteå Municipality, Västerbotten. He died on 25 April 2020 in Vaxholm of multiple organ failure. He was 85.
